How much do software developer support j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 11, 2026, the average yearly pay for software developer support in the United States is $111,845.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$90,000.00 and $130,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Software Developer Support vs Software Engineer?

AspectSoftware Developer SupportSoftware Engineer
Primary RoleProvides technical assistance, troubleshooting, and support for software productsDesigns, develops, and maintains software applications and systems
Required SkillsCustomer service, troubleshooting, basic codingAdvanced programming, system design, software architecture
Work EnvironmentSupport centers, client sites, help desksDevelopment teams, R&D labs, tech companies
CertificationsOften includes certifications like CompTIA, Microsoft, or vendor-specific support certsTypically requires degrees in CS or related fields, with certifications like AWS, Cisco, or programming certifications

In summary, Software Developer Support focuses on assisting users and troubleshooting existing software, while Software Engineers are involved in creating and designing new software solutions. Both roles require technical knowledge, but their responsibilities and work environments differ significantly.

Job description

Location: Springfield, VA (Hybrid / On-Site)

Clearance Requirement: U.S. Citizenship & Ability to Obtain/Maintain a U.S. Security Clearance


TITANONEZERO is seeking a driven, self-starting Software Developer to contribute to the design, development, and maintenance of our next-generation software applications. Working in an active Agile environment, you will collaborate with senior engineers to build scalable code across web, embedded, or backend systems.

This role is ideal for an ambitious developer looking to grow their foundational software engineering skills, gain exposure to modern tech stacks, and contribute directly to mission-critical projects.


Key Responsibilities

  • Software Development: Write clean, efficient, and maintainable code under the mentorship of senior software engineers.
  • Feature Development & Testing: Build, unit test, and deploy features for web, backend, or embedded software components.
  • Agile Collaboration: Actively participate in sprint planning sessions, daily stand-ups, and peer code reviews.
  • Integration & Debugging: Assist in troubleshooting, debugging, and integrating COTS systems with custom internal applications.
  • Lifecycle & CI/CD Support: Support application deployment and monitoring across cloud (AWS/Azure) or on-premise infrastructure while maintaining Git version control best practices.
  • Technical Documentation: Maintain accurate documentation for code architectures, API endpoints, and system workflows.

Required Qualifications

  • Education / Experience: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Software Engineering, or a related STEM field (or equivalent practical experience).
  • Programming Skills: Foundational proficiency in at least one modern programming language (e.g., Python, C++, Java, or JavaScript/TypeScript).
  • Core Concepts: Solid understanding of software design principles, version control (Git), and Agile development frameworks.
  • Security Clearance: Must be a U.S. Citizen with the ability to obtain and maintain a U.S. Security Clearance.
  • Mindset: Strong analytical problem-solving skills and a proactive drive to master new frameworks and technologies.
